summ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orreyk <reyk@openbsd.org>2014-07-13 14:46:52 +0000
committerreyk <reyk@openbsd.org>2014-07-13 14:46:52 +0000
commitf73fddb56f7c777251595da556d5ce022de6b2e2 (patch)
tree3459a8222be15367d6ee27321186fe8558b5ec25
parentoops, i deleted the wrong word (diff)
downloadwireguard-openbsd-f73fddb56f7c777251595da556d5ce022de6b2e2.tar.xz
wireguard-openbsd-f73fddb56f7c777251595da556d5ce022de6b2e2.zip
Close the connection after the response is completed (no Keepalive yet).
-rw-r--r--usr.sbin/httpd/server.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/usr.sbin/httpd/server.c b/usr.sbin/httpd/server.c
index e963492481f..f461e5f8bba 100644
--- a/usr.sbin/httpd/server.c
+++ b/usr.sbin/httpd/server.c
@@ -1,4 +1,4 @@
-/* $OpenBSD: server.c,v 1.2 2014/07/13 14:17:37 reyk Exp $ */
+/* $OpenBSD: server.c,v 1.3 2014/07/13 14:46:52 reyk Exp $ */
/*
* Copyright (c) 2006 - 2014 Reyk Floeter <reyk@openbsd.org>
@@ -397,9 +397,9 @@ server_error(struct bufferevent *bev, short error, void *arg)
bufferevent_disable(bev, EV_READ|EV_WRITE);
clt->clt_done = 1;
+ server_close(clt, "done");
return;
-// server_close(con, "done");
}
server_close(clt, "buffer event error");
return;